2. Portability
When purchasing a treadmill that folds it is important to determine the ease of its unfold and store. Find a treadmill that folds with a sturdy design and added transport features like built-in or attached carry handles for greater mobility. Also, consider the deck size as it is a major element in determining whether a folding treadmill will be suitable for your needs. In the ideal scenario, you should make sure that the deck is long enough to support your feet to run on and wide enough to accommodate normal or natural strides. If you are an avid runner, choose a treadmill that has at minimum 55 inches in length and 20 inches in width.

4. Safety
Foldable treadmills pose a safety risk if not properly secured and folded. They can be a trip or fall hazard, so it's important to ensure they're folded and secured in place before making use of them or letting pets or children play on them. They should be kept in a clean, secure space with plenty of space behind them. Cords are to be wrapped or tucked away when not in use.

Many folding treadmills have safety features to help prevent injuries. For instance, some treadmills are equipped with sensors that sense when something or someone is underneath the treadmill and slows down and stops. This feature is a major benefit for people who don't have time to inspect their treadmills before they start exercising.
It's also important to regularly clean and lubricate your treadmill. This will help keep it running smoothly and reduce wear and tear, which will prolong its life. Follow the manufacturer's guidelines for maintenance and cleaning. Make sure your equipment is clean to decrease the chance of mold and bacterial growth that can cause respiratory problems. Always wear the right shoes when you use any kind of treadmill. This will help protect your feet.
